fn inner_dependency_inherit_with<'a>(
pkg_dep: manifest::TomlInheritedDependency,
name: &str,
inherit: &dyn Fn() -> CargoResult<&'a InheritableFields>,
package_root: &Path,
edition: Edition,
warnings: &mut Vec<String>,
) -> CargoResult<manifest::TomlDependency> {
let ws_dep = inherit()?.get_dependency(name, package_root)?;
let mut merged_dep = match ws_dep {
manifest::TomlDependency::Simple(ws_version) => manifest::TomlDetailedDependency {
version: Some(ws_version),
..Default::default()
},
manifest::TomlDependency::Detailed(ws_dep) => ws_dep.clone(),
};
let manifest::TomlInheritedDependency {
workspace: _,
features,
optional,
default_features,
default_features2,
public,
_unused_keys: _,
} = &pkg_dep;
let default_features = default_features.or(*default_features2);
match (default_features, merged_dep.default_features()) {
// member: default-features = true and
// workspace: default-features = false should turn on
// default-features
(Some(true), Some(false)) => {
merged_dep.default_features = Some(true);
}
// member: default-features = false and
// workspace: default-features = true should ignore member
// default-features
(Some(false), Some(true)) => {
deprecated_ws_default_features(name, Some(true), edition, warnings)?;
}
// member: default-features = false and
// workspace: dep = "1.0" should ignore member default-features
(Some(false), None) => {
deprecated_ws_default_features(name, None, edition, warnings)?;
}
_ => {}
}
merged_dep.features = match (merged_dep.features.clone(), features.clone()) {
(Some(dep_feat), Some(inherit_feat)) => Some(
dep_feat
.into_iter()
.chain(inherit_feat)
.collect::<Vec<String>>(),
),
(Some(dep_fet), None) => Some(dep_fet),
(None, Some(inherit_feat)) => Some(inherit_feat),
(None, None) => None,
};
merged_dep.optional = *optional;
merged_dep.public = *public;
Ok(manifest::TomlDependency::Detailed(merged_dep))
}
fn deprecated_ws_default_features(
label: &str,
ws_def_feat: Option<bool>,
edition: Edition,
warnings: &mut Vec<String>,
) -> CargoResult<()> {
let ws_def_feat = match ws_def_feat {
Some(true) => "true",
Some(false) => "false",
None => "not specified",
};
if Edition::Edition2024 <= edition {
anyhow::bail!("`default-features = false` cannot override workspace's `default-features`");
} else {
warnings.push(format!(
"`default-features` is ignored for {label}, since `default-features` was \
{ws_def_feat} for `workspace.dependencies.{label}`, \
this could become a hard error in the future"
));
}
Ok(())
}

fn to_dependency_source_id<P: ResolveToPath + Clone>(
orig: &manifest::TomlDetailedDependency<P>,
name_in_toml: &str,
manifest_ctx: &mut ManifestContext<'_, '_>,
) -> CargoResult<SourceId> {
match (
orig.git.as_ref(),
orig.path.as_ref(),
orig.registry.as_deref(),
orig.registry_index.as_ref(),
) {
(Some(_git), Some(_path), _, _) => {
bail!(
"dependency ({name_in_toml}) specification is ambiguous. \
Only one of `git` or `path` is allowed.",
);
}
(_, _, Some(_registry), Some(_registry_index)) => bail!(
"dependency ({name_in_toml}) specification is ambiguous. \
Only one of `registry` or `registry-index` is allowed.",
),
(Some(git), None, _, _) => {
let n_details = [&orig.branch, &orig.tag, &orig.rev]
.iter()
.filter(|d| d.is_some())
.count();
if n_details > 1 {
bail!(
"dependency ({name_in_toml}) specification is ambiguous. \
Only one of `branch`, `tag` or `rev` is allowed.",
);
}
let reference = orig
.branch
.clone()
.map(GitReference::Branch)
.or_else(|| orig.tag.clone().map(GitReference::Tag))
.or_else(|| orig.rev.clone().map(GitReference::Rev))
.unwrap_or(GitReference::DefaultBranch);
let loc = git.into_url()?;
if let Some(fragment) = loc.fragment() {
let msg = format!(
"URL fragment `#{fragment}` in git URL is ignored for dependency ({name_in_toml}). \
If you were trying to specify a specific git revision, \
use `rev = \"{fragment}\"` in the dependency declaration.",
);
manifest_ctx.warnings.push(msg);
}
SourceId::for_git(&loc, reference)
}
(None, Some(path), _, _) => {
let path = path.resolve(manifest_ctx.gctx);
// If the source ID for the package we're parsing is a path
// source, then we normalize the path here to get rid of
// components like `..`.
//
// The purpose of this is to get a canonical ID for the package
// that we're depending on to ensure that builds of this package
// always end up hashing to the same value no matter where it's
// built from.
if manifest_ctx.source_id.is_path() {
let path = manifest_ctx.file.parent().unwrap().join(path);
let path = paths::normalize_path(&path);
SourceId::for_path(&path)
} else {
Ok(manifest_ctx.source_id)
}
}
(None, None, Some(registry), None) => SourceId::alt_registry(manifest_ctx.gctx, registry),
(None, None, None, Some(registry_index)) => {
let url = registry_index.into_url()?;
SourceId::for_registry(&url)
}
(None, None, None, None) => SourceId::crates_io(manifest_ctx.gctx),
}
}

/// Checks syntax validity and unstable feature gate for each profile.
///
/// It's a bit unfortunate both `-Z` flags and `cargo-features` are required,
/// because profiles can now be set in either `Cargo.toml` or `config.toml`.
fn validate_profiles(
profiles: &manifest::TomlProfiles,
cli_unstable: &CliUnstable,
features: &Features,
warnings: &mut Vec<String>,
) -> CargoResult<()> {
for (name, profile) in &profiles.0 {
validate_profile(profile, name, cli_unstable, features, warnings)?;
}
Ok(())
}
/// Checks syntax validity and unstable feature gate for a given profile.
pub fn validate_profile(
root: &manifest::TomlProfile,
name: &str,
cli_unstable: &CliUnstable,
features: &Features,
warnings: &mut Vec<String>,
) -> CargoResult<()> {
validate_profile_layer(root, cli_unstable, features)?;
if let Some(ref profile) = root.build_override {
validate_profile_override(profile, "build-override")?;
validate_profile_layer(profile, cli_unstable, features)?;
}
if let Some(ref packages) = root.package {
for profile in packages.values() {
validate_profile_override(profile, "package")?;
validate_profile_layer(profile, cli_unstable, features)?;
}
}
if let Some(dir_name) = &root.dir_name {
// This is disabled for now, as we would like to stabilize named
// profiles without this, and then decide in the future if it is
// needed. This helps simplify the UI a little.
bail!(
"dir-name=\"{}\" in profile `{}` is not currently allowed, \
directory names are tied to the profile name for custom profiles",
dir_name,
name
);
}
// `inherits` validation
if matches!(root.inherits.as_deref(), Some("debug")) {
bail!(
"profile.{}.inherits=\"debug\" should be profile.{}.inherits=\"dev\"",
name,
name
);
}
match name {
"doc" => {
warnings.push("profile `doc` is deprecated and has no effect".to_string());
}
"test" | "bench" => {
if root.panic.is_some() {
warnings.push(format!("`panic` setting is ignored for `{}` profile", name))
}
}
_ => {}
}
if let Some(panic) = &root.panic {
if panic != "unwind" && panic != "abort" && panic != "immediate-abort" {
bail!(
"`panic` setting of `{}` is not a valid setting, \
must be `unwind`, `abort`, or `immediate-abort`.",
panic
);
}
}
if let Some(manifest::StringOrBool::String(arg)) = &root.lto {
if arg == "true" || arg == "false" {
bail!(
"`lto` setting of string `\"{arg}\"` for `{name}` profile is not \
a valid setting, must be a boolean (`true`/`false`) or a string \
(`\"thin\"`/`\"fat\"`/`\"off\"`) or omitted.",
);
}
}
Ok(())
}
/// Validates a profile.
///
/// This is a shallow check, which is reused for the profile itself and any overrides.
fn validate_profile_layer(
profile: &manifest::TomlProfile,
cli_unstable: &CliUnstable,
features: &Features,
) -> CargoResult<()> {
if profile.codegen_backend.is_some() {
match (
features.require(Feature::codegen_backend()),
cli_unstable.codegen_backend,
) {
(Err(e), false) => return Err(e),
_ => {}
}
}
if profile.rustflags.is_some() {
match (
features.require(Feature::profile_rustflags()),
cli_unstable.profile_rustflags,
) {
(Err(e), false) => return Err(e),
_ => {}
}
}
if profile.trim_paths.is_some() {
match (
features.require(Feature::trim_paths()),
cli_unstable.trim_paths,
) {
(Err(e), false) => return Err(e),
_ => {}
}
}
if profile.panic.as_deref() == Some("immediate-abort") {
match (
features.require(Feature::panic_immediate_abort()),
cli_unstable.panic_immediate_abort,
) {
(Err(e), false) => return Err(e),
_ => {}
}
}
Ok(())
}
/// Validation that is specific to an override.
fn validate_profile_override(profile: &manifest::TomlProfile, which: &str) -> CargoResult<()> {
if profile.package.is_some() {
bail!("package-specific profiles cannot be nested");
}
if profile.build_override.is_some() {
bail!("build-override profiles cannot be nested");
}
if profile.panic.is_some() {
bail!("`panic` may not be specified in a `{}` profile", which)
}
if profile.lto.is_some() {
bail!("`lto` may not be specified in a `{}` profile", which)
}
if profile.rpath.is_some() {
bail!("`rpath` may not be specified in a `{}` profile", which)
}
Ok(())
}

fn lints_to_rustflags(lints: &manifest::TomlLints) -> CargoResult<Vec<String>> {
let mut rustflags = lints
.iter()
// We don't want to pass any of the `cargo` lints to `rustc`
.filter(|(tool, _)| tool != &"cargo")
.flat_map(|(tool, lints)| {
lints.iter().map(move |(name, config)| {
let flag = match config.level() {
manifest::TomlLintLevel::Forbid => "--forbid",
manifest::TomlLintLevel::Deny => "--deny",
manifest::TomlLintLevel::Warn => "--warn",
manifest::TomlLintLevel::Allow => "--allow",
};
let option = if tool == "rust" {
format!("{flag}={name}")
} else {
format!("{flag}={tool}::{name}")
};
(
config.priority(),
// Since the most common group will be `all`, put it last so people are more
// likely to notice that they need to use `priority`.
std::cmp::Reverse(name),
option,
)
})
})
.collect::<Vec<_>>();
rustflags.sort();
let mut rustflags: Vec<_> = rustflags.into_iter().map(|(_, _, option)| option).collect();
// Also include the custom arguments specified in `[lints.rust.unexpected_cfgs.check_cfg]`
if let Some(rust_lints) = lints.get("rust") {
if let Some(unexpected_cfgs) = rust_lints.get("unexpected_cfgs") {
if let Some(config) = unexpected_cfgs.config() {
if let Some(check_cfg) = config.get("check-cfg") {
if let Ok(check_cfgs) = toml::Value::try_into::<Vec<String>>(check_cfg.clone())
{
for check_cfg in check_cfgs {
rustflags.push("--check-cfg".to_string());
rustflags.push(check_cfg);
}
// error about `check-cfg` not being a list-of-string
} else {
bail!("`lints.rust.unexpected_cfgs.check-cfg` must be a list of string");
}
}
}
}
}
Ok(rustflags)
}
